Anyway, VOIP, I have been looking into asterisk (*) which is a software PBX for the linux platform. It allows for all the standard pbx features (call routing, extensions, call transfer multiple trunks etc) plus voicemail, Automated attendants, queueing, and as its GPL’d there are a tonne of add in modules. It supports SIP and AIX2 Voip Trunk protocols (amongst others) and then inbound and outbound routes based on anything from caller id, to incoming line, or serial port (for POTS ‘Plain old telephone system’ lines… (you do need a seperate (80 quid) voice card for that tho))
So yeah, i’d suggest you try it out if you need a small-medium pbx. Im just using it at home, but its great, because as I will be moving out of student halls soon, my phone number will stay with me wherever I am, and I dont need to pay BT a line rental :D
Im using a VOIP company called ‘voiptalk.co.uk’ to buy the IAX trunk credit. (This gives you setting to route calls through a IAX asterisk trunk… to the POTS (ie 0161 xxx xxx - standard phone numbers
(mobiles too)) for really cheap prices (1.2p/Min UK Landline, 11p/min Mobile UK) which I didn’t think was bad.
Anyway, if your interested have a gander. (Search for ‘trixbox’ its asterisk packaged up in an easy to install Linux distro, based on CentOS, with built in web gui (freepbx) and call routing manager)

We had a spare pc knocking around, so thats now in the living room, with a t-amp and some speakers, on ubuntu, constantly connected to a shoutcast server which martin is currently running. This in turn is getting its content from a instance of winamp on the same server, which is running the winamp web interface, so anyone in the house can put songs on / add / change the playlist from their pc / pda. Seems to be working quite well.
Of course, anyone else in the house can also connect to the stream and listen to the same music in their rooms! (Killers - Everything will be alright) at the mo :)
